Photo by Russell Porter
Find hotels in Dirleton, Edinburgh from AED 204
- Plan, book, stay with confidence
Be picky
Search almost a million properties worldwide
Change your mind
Book hotels with free cancellation
Check availability on hotels close to Dirleton
Discover 3,392 Dirleton hotels and places to stay, with room rates, reviews, and availability. Most hotels are fully refundable.
Marine North Berwick
Marine North Berwick
8.8 out of 10, Excellent, (206)
The price is AED 751
AED 901 total
includes taxes & fees
5 Jan - 6 January 2025
Pine Marten, Dunbar by Marston's Inns
Pine Marten, Dunbar by Marston's Inns
8.6 out of 10, Excellent, (274)
The price is AED 204
AED 244 total
includes taxes & fees
3 Jan - 4 January 2025
The Linton Hotel
The Linton Hotel
8.4 out of 10, Very Good, (375)
The price is AED 269
AED 323 total
includes taxes & fees
2 Jan - 3 January 2025
Bayswell Park Hotel
Bayswell Park Hotel
8.6 out of 10, Excellent, (411)
The price is AED 377
AED 453 total
includes taxes & fees
24 Dec - 25 Dec
Greywalls Hotel and Chez Roux
Greywalls Hotel and Chez Roux
9.2 out of 10, Wonderful, (171)
The price is AED 987
AED 1,184 total
includes taxes & fees
2 Jan - 3 January 2025
Nether Abbey Hotel
Nether Abbey Hotel
9.4 out of 10, Exceptional, (135)
The price is AED 519
AED 623 total
includes taxes & fees
6 Jan - 7 January 2025
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Save an average of 15% on thousands of hotels when you're signed in
Where to stay in Dirleton
Where to stay in Dirleton
Hotels in top Edinburgh neighborhoods Learn more about Dirleton
Edinburgh City Centre
6 out of top 10 points of interest in this area
While you're in Edinburgh City Centre, take in top sights like Edinburgh Castle or Scott Monument, and hop on the metro to see more the city at St Andrew Square Tram Stop or Princes Street Tram Stop.
Recent reviews of Dirleton hotels
Recent reviews of Dirleton hotels
5/5 Excellent
"We had a dirty towel, the room needs some attention in bathroom the ventilation in bathroom wasn’t working right have a shower everything soaked condensation, comfy bed tho. "
A verified traveler stayed at Leonardo Royal Hotel Edinburgh
Posted 2 days ago
Explore a world of travel with Expedia
Explore a world of travel with Expedia
Hotels in top Edinburgh neighborhoods
- Hotels in Edinburgh City Centre
- Hotels in Old Town Edinburgh
- Hotels in New Town
- Hotels in Leith
- Hotels in Haymarket
- Hotels in Tollcross
- Hotels in Southside
- Hotels in West End
- Hotels in Murrayfield
- Hotels in Merchiston
- Hotels in Stockbridge
- Hotels in Morningside
- Hotels in Portobello
- Hotels in Newington
- Hotels in Bruntsfield
- Hotels in Corstorphine
- Hotels in Marchmont
- Hotels in Gorgie
- Hotels in Holyrood
- Hotels in Ingliston
Hotels near popular Edinburgh Attractions
- Hotels near Dirleton Castle
- Hotels near Edinburgh Castle
- Hotels near Royal Mile
- Hotels near Princes Street
- Hotels near Edinburgh Playhouse Theatre
- Hotels near University of Edinburgh
- Hotels near Murrayfield Stadium
- Hotels near George Street
- Hotels near Grassmarket
- Hotels near Edinburgh International Conference Centre
More Accommodation Types in Dirleton
- Apartments in Edinburgh
- Vacation Homes in Edinburgh
- Cottages in Edinburgh
- Guest Houses in Edinburgh
- Hostels in Edinburgh
- Aparthotels in Edinburgh
- B&B in Edinburgh
- Lodges in Edinburgh
- Inns in Edinburgh
- Condo Rentals in Edinburgh
- Villas in Edinburgh
- Residences in Edinburgh
- Cabin Rentals in Edinburgh
- Capsule Hotels in Edinburgh
- RV Parks in Edinburgh
- Castles in Edinburgh
Hotels Close to Nearby Airports
Dirleton Hotels by Star Rating
Dirleton Hotels by Brand
Explore more hotels
- Virgin Hotels Edinburgh
- Old Waverley Hotel
- Point A Hotel Edinburgh Haymarket
- Eleven Stafford Street Townhouse Adults Only
- Leonardo Royal Hotel Edinburgh
- Motel One Edinburgh - Royal
- Sheraton Grand Hotel & Spa, Edinburgh
- Wilde Aparthotels, Edinburgh, Grassmarket
- easyHotel Edinburgh
- Aparthotel Adagio Edinburgh Royal Mile
- ibis Edinburgh Centre South Bridge - Royal Mile
- Edinburgh Marriott Hotel Holyrood